Hello Guys, can any one here help, i have a Toyota Landcruiser, it's a 4.2 12v DDJ 100, 1995, and it has a charging fault and dash fault.
It's not the alt: it's a new one, all the dash lights are on when running the motor and it wont charge the batt:.
I don't see a batt: charge light when key is on, not to sure if there is one.
However on the 3 pin plug of the alt: a supply is missing, putting a supply there makes it charge, and the dash lights go out all is fine.
What i don't know is where the supply to one of the 3 small wires to the alt: come from to repair the fault, i have checked all fuses and all seam ok, is there a charge relay?, if so where.

Hi Gibbmodoll.
I think you may have the idea, but how the batt charge light works by:
When you turn the ign on, it puts a supply up to the lamp, and then the other side of the lamp goes to the alternator to earth it (as such) but when
you start the car and the alternator starts to charge the voltage gets higher than the battery voltage , and so turns out the lamp.
But the wattage of the lamp is critical.
